Event planning is sold on evidence: a client scrolls real events you have run and decides quickly whether you are the right fit for theirs. We build custom event planner websites with fast-loading galleries organized by event type, package and pricing tiers, date-availability inquiry forms, and vendor and venue relationship pages. Hand-coded for Lighthouse 100 speed and optimized for wedding, corporate, and local event searches. Galleries stay sharp and load instantly, because a slow portfolio is a portfolio nobody sees. Modern image formats, correct sizing, and lazy loading below the fold. The portfolio stays sharp while still hitting a perfect Lighthouse score.
Yes. They are different buyers with different budgets, so each gets its own section, its own portfolio, and its own inquiry path.
The inquiry form captures the event date first, so you can triage by availability before spending time on a consultation that cannot happen.
